Monthly weather averages (˚C)

Discover Serenity and Vibrance: The Hidden Gem of Laurel Park

Nestled in the vibrant city of Sarasota, Florida, Laurel Park is a hidden gem that blends urban charm with natural beauty. This quaint neighborhood boasts serene streets lined with lush greenery, making it perfect for leisurely strolls and family outings. Just a stone's throw away, visitors can explore the stunning beaches, indulge in local cuisine, or take in the cultural offerings of nearby attractions like the Ringling Museum. With its inviting atmosphere and proximity to both nature and city life, Laurel Park is an ideal vacation getaway for those seeking relaxation and adventure in one captivating destination.

Things to do near Laurel Park

Laurel Park is a delightful blend of urban charm and natural beauty, boasting sandy beaches and lush parks perfect for leisurely strolls. Enjoy recreational activities like boating or hiking nearby trails, while family-friendly shopping areas and golf spots offer plenty of fun. It's an ideal escape for everyone!

  • John and Mable Ringling Museum of ArtOpens in a new window – Step into a world of creativity at this iconic museum. Marvel at the impressive collection of artworks and explore the beautiful grounds that showcase the rich history of the Ringling family. Don’t miss the stunning architecture and the chance to learn about the circus legacy that shaped Sarasota.
  • Lido BeachOpens in a new window – Sink your toes into the soft sand at Lido Beach, where the sparkling Gulf waters invite you for a refreshing dip. Whether you're building sandcastles with the kids or enjoying a peaceful stroll along the shoreline, this beach offers a perfect day in the sun.
  • Marina JackOpens in a new window – Head over to Marina Jack for a delightful waterfront experience. Enjoy a leisurely meal at the marina's restaurant while watching boats glide by. You can also rent a boat or take a scenic cruise to soak in the beautiful Sarasota Bay.
  • Marie Selby Botanical GardensOpens in a new window – Discover the lush flora at Marie Selby Botanical Gardens, where vibrant plants and serene landscapes await. Wander through the tropical gardens, marvel at the rare orchids, and relax in the peaceful atmosphere that feels like a hidden oasis in the city.
  • St. Armands CircleOpens in a new window – Stroll around St. Armands Circle, a charming shopping and dining destination. Browse the unique boutiques and enjoy a delicious meal at one of the many outdoor cafés. This lively area is perfect for finding that special souvenir or simply enjoying the vibrant ambiance.

How to Get to Laurel Park

Flying to:

  • Sarasota-Bradenton Intl. Airport (SRQ), 4 mi (6.4 km) from Laurel Park
  • St. Petersburg, FL (SPG-Albert Whitted), 30.5 mi (49.1 km) from Laurel Park

When Is the Best Time to Visit Sarasota?

  • Hottest months: August, July, June, September (average 83°F)
  • Coldest months: January, February, December, March (average 66°F)
  • Rainiest months: August, July, September, June (average 8 inches of rainfall)
